What is a Custom Home?
Unlike pre-built homes, a custom home is designed and built specifically for you. It is built from scratch to reflect your individuality, lifestyle, and preferences, from the building layout and style to the interior materials, features, and finishes. The primary benefit of custom homes is unparalleled freedom and flexibility, allowing you to select everything to suit your specific needs, from the building layout, size, materials, finishes, and any unique features. Ultimately, custom-built homes can help you bring your dream home to reality.
Benefits of Building a Custom Home
Custom-built homes offer numerous benefits that pre-built homes cannot provide. These include:
- Personalization
Obviously, the biggest benefit of building a custom home is the unparalleled level of personalization it offers. When purchasing a pre-owned home, you are often stuck with the existing features and layouts, and design choices of the previous owner. However, with a custom home, you can tailor literally every aspect of the home to your unique needs and preferences. From the floor plan to the interior finishes and fixtures and the number and size of rooms to the color of the walls, a custom home is a blank slate that allows you to create a one-of-a-kind space that truly reflects your style.
With custom homes, you can make design choices suited to your lifestyle. For instance, if you have a large family with young children, you can opt for a floor plan that maximizes outdoor space for playtime, or if you work from home, you may include a dedicated home office space in your home design. Basically, you can choose how you want your dream home to look, and that’s a benefit you can’t get any other way but with a custom home.

- Energy Efficiency
In an era where sustainability and energy conservation are crucial, custom homes provide an excellent opportunity to integrate all new energy-efficient appliances and features. When building a custom home, you can incorporate elements such as improved heating and cooling systems, insulating paddings, energy-efficient lighting, water-saving plumbing features, and smart home systems which can help reduce energy consumption and reduce utility bills.

- Cost Control and Budget Flexibility
It is a common belief that building a custom home is more expensive than purchasing an existing home. This isn’t always true; a custom-built home is only more expensive if you choose it. Although the initial investment may be higher than purchasing an existing home, building a custom home can be a cost-effective option in the long run, as you have better control over your budget. You can decide which special features and materials goes into building your home. This means you control the price point of each detail that goes into building your home.
Your custom home builder can help you stay within your budget from the start to the finish of the project as you prioritize and allocate funds based on your needs and preferences, avoiding unnecessary expenses on features that are not important to you.
